Wood Memorial typically has all the answers at home, but on Monday Barr-Reeve proved too difficult a challenge. They put the hurt on the Wood Memorial Trojans with a sharp 3-0 victory. Winning may never get old, but the Vikings sure are getting used to it with their third in a row.

The 3-0 score doesn't show just how dominant Barr-Reeve was: they took every set by at least 13 points. The match finished with set scores of 25-3, 25-11, 25-12.

Addison Jones was a one-man wrecking crew for Barr-Reeve as she had 11 digs, ten kills, two blocks, and two aces. Jones is on a roll when it comes to kills, as she's now had seven or more in the last five games she's played. Josie Knepp was another key player, getting seven digs, three aces, and a kill.

She wasn't the only good server: Barr-Reeve was lethal from the service line and finished the game with 11 aces.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now served at least five aces in 11 consecutive matches.

Barr-Reeve has been performing incredibly well recently as they've won eight of their last nine games, which provided a nice bump to their 21-5 record this season. As for Wood Memorial, their defeat ended an eight-game streak of wins at home and dropped them to 12-7.
